Grow with AppMaster Grow with AppMaster.
Become our partner arrow ico

Documentación de funciones personalizadas

La documentación de funciones personalizadas, en el contexto de AppMaster, se refiere a la colección de materiales escritos que explican detalladamente cómo se diseña, implementa y utiliza una función personalizada dentro de las aplicaciones de la plataforma. Las funciones personalizadas son scripts o bloques de código definidos por el usuario que amplían las capacidades integradas de las aplicaciones AppMaster para manejar requisitos comerciales o casos de uso específicos. Dicha documentación es crucial para ayudar a los desarrolladores, usuarios y otras partes interesadas a comprender el propósito, la funcionalidad, los parámetros y el uso de funciones personalizadas en el contexto de los proyectos de la plataforma AppMaster.

Documentar adecuadamente las funciones personalizadas garantiza que todos los miembros del equipo tengan una comprensión clara de su propósito y uso, lo que en última instancia aumenta la eficiencia del equipo y reduce el riesgo de posibles errores o malentendidos. La documentación de funciones personalizadas de alta calidad sirve como base de conocimientos para los usuarios actuales y futuros, permitiéndoles ponerse al día rápidamente con las funciones personalizadas de las aplicaciones AppMaster.

Normalmente, la documentación de funciones personalizadas consta de varios componentes, que incluyen:

  • Descripción general y propósito: una breve introducción y fundamento de la función personalizada, explicando su propósito principal y su relevancia para la aplicación.
  • Parámetros de entrada: una descripción de los parámetros de entrada aceptados por la función personalizada, incluidos sus nombres, tipos de datos y cualquier restricción o condición previa asociada con ellos.
  • Salida: una descripción de la salida de la función personalizada, incluido el tipo de datos, la estructura y cualquier poscondición o garantía proporcionada por la función.
  • Firma de función: la firma de la función personalizada, que detalla su nombre completo, incluidos los espacios de nombres o referencias de módulos requeridos, junto con sus tipos de entrada y salida.
  • Ejemplos y uso: ejemplos concretos y fragmentos de código de muestra que ilustran cómo se puede utilizar la función personalizada dentro de la plataforma, a menudo acompañados de explicaciones y mejores prácticas para garantizar una implementación adecuada.
  • Dependencias e integración: información sobre las dependencias, bibliotecas o servicios externos de los que depende la función personalizada para funcionar correctamente, así como instrucciones para integrar la función personalizada con otros componentes de la pila de aplicaciones AppMaster.
  • Limitaciones y riesgos conocidos: documentar las limitaciones conocidas, los casos extremos y los riesgos potenciales asociados con el uso de la función personalizada, además de proporcionar recomendaciones y estrategias de mitigación para abordar estas preocupaciones de manera efectiva.
  • Casos de prueba y validación: resumen de los casos de prueba, incluidos pares de entrada-salida y condiciones de contorno, que deben usarse para validar la corrección y efectividad de la función personalizada, asegurando que funcione como se espera en todos los escenarios aplicables.

La documentación de funciones personalizadas debe seguir un formato y una guía de estilo coherentes, lo que garantiza uniformidad y facilidad de navegación en toda la documentación. Esta coherencia facilita a los desarrolladores y usuarios localizar la información requerida, acelerando el proceso de aprendizaje y reduciendo la probabilidad de errores.

En AppMaster, se enfatiza la importancia de una documentación integral de funciones personalizadas, dada la naturaleza de la plataforma y el público objetivo. Como AppMaster es una plataforma no-code, permite a los usuarios con distintos niveles de experiencia técnica crear aplicaciones sofisticadas. Una documentación adecuada de funciones personalizadas beneficia significativamente a esta base diversa de usuarios, ya que sirve como recurso de guía para aquellos que no están familiarizados con los principios de programación o funciones personalizadas específicas dentro de la plataforma.

Para cuantificar los beneficios de una documentación de funciones personalizadas eficaz, los estudios han demostrado que un código bien documentado reduce el tiempo dedicado a la depuración hasta en un 50 %, y una documentación exhaustiva puede reducir los costos de mantenimiento del software hasta en un 20 %. Con el enfoque de AppMaster en eliminar la deuda técnica y garantizar un desarrollo fluido de aplicaciones, la documentación de funciones personalizadas desempeña un papel crucial en el éxito de la plataforma.

En conclusión, la documentación de funciones personalizadas es un aspecto integral de la plataforma AppMaster, que permite a los usuarios crear, comprender y utilizar funciones personalizadas de manera efectiva. Al seguir las mejores prácticas para producir documentación integral, coherente y de alta calidad, los desarrolladores y usuarios de todos los niveles de experiencia pueden obtener los beneficios de un menor tiempo de depuración y mantenimiento, una mayor eficiencia del aprendizaje y una mejor comprensión de las características personalizadas de sus aplicaciones AppMaster.

Entradas relacionadas

Cómo un generador de aplicaciones de IA sin código le ayuda a crear software empresarial personalizado
Cómo un generador de aplicaciones de IA sin código le ayuda a crear software empresarial personalizado
Descubra el poder de los desarrolladores de aplicaciones de IA sin código para crear software empresarial personalizado. Explore cómo estas herramientas permiten un desarrollo eficiente y democratizan la creación de software.
Cómo aumentar la productividad con un programa de mapeo visual
Cómo aumentar la productividad con un programa de mapeo visual
Mejore su productividad con un programa de mapeo visual. Descubra técnicas, beneficios e información práctica para optimizar los flujos de trabajo mediante herramientas visuales.
Una guía completa sobre lenguajes de programación visual para principiantes
Una guía completa sobre lenguajes de programación visual para principiantes
Descubra el mundo de los lenguajes de programación visual diseñados para principiantes. Conozca sus beneficios, características clave, ejemplos populares y cómo simplifican la codificación.
EMPIEZA GRATIS
¿Inspirado para probar esto usted mismo?

La mejor manera de comprender el poder de AppMaster es verlo por sí mismo. Haz tu propia aplicación en minutos con suscripción gratuita

Da vida a tus ideas